Advanced Practice Nurse/Trauma Coordinator

HealthcareSource Medical Center (Services admin-only migration)
Hampstead, New Hampshire, United States, 03841
Full-time

The APN / Trauma Coordinator provides health and medical care in the ED. This position performs comprehensive health assessments and promotes wellness and prevention of illness and injury.

The position also develops differential diagnosis, orders and conductd, supervised and interpretd diagnostic and lab tests, and prescribes pharmacologic and non-pharmacologic treatments in the direct management of acute and chronic illness and disease.

A master''s degree from a professional school of nursing is required, as is Illinios licensure as an APN. Four years of professional nursing experience, including two years of critical care or emergency nursing in a Trauma Center is required.
